AshAsh... our main character in the ever popular Pokémon world. Starting with a humble begining, Ash was a cocky novice that dreamed of being the best Pokémon master. He lived in Pallet Town with his mother, Deliela. He eagerly waited for his time to become a Pokémon trainer, and recieve his first Pokémon. The day finally arrived, but he had overslept and made it to Professor Oak's Lab late! Now because of his foolishness, the other Pallet Town trainers, including Ash's rival, Gary, had already recieved their Pokémon and were on their way! Ash begged Professor Oak if there were any left. Professor Oak of course had one left... but warned Ash that it was an untamed Pokémon and would be difficult to handle. Ash was enthralled at the challenged and accepted his new Pokémon with open arms. The Pokémon didn't recieve his new master the same way. Pikachu, an electric mouse, shocked Ash, and was as grumpy as ever. He wouldn't even go into his Pokéball! Ash didn't mind, he dragged Pikachu along with rubber gloves and began his long journey with a rough start...

But Ash, determined and hard-headed as ever, won Pikachu over after a whole ordeal with some Spearow and Fearow. Ash won Pikachu's trust and love, and they became the best of friends and companions. Ash became more compassionate and learned new things as he continued his journey...Soon, Ash would make new friends, including Misty, Brock, and many others; and enemies, like Team Rocket who would attempt to steal Pikachu whenever they could but to no avail. Ash learned to befriend his Pokémon, to train them hard, and to always listen to their feelings. He was never dettered by any obsticle, and always thrived at a challenge.

As a trainer, Ash was to catch and train Pokémon. Although his rival Gary had the upper hand in catching more Pokémon, Ash would make it up in heart and skill. His first Pokémon catch: Caterpie. With the Pokéball thrown, Ash was determined to catch this Pokémon (although Misty wasn't too happy about it!) He didn't mind, for he was happy and satisfied with his new Pokémon. However, Ash's inexperience almost cost him when he had chose to use
Caterpie against a Pidgeotto! Now as we all know, Bug types are waaaay weak to Birds (in this case Flying) types! Ash was lucky though, because then he won just barely and caught the Pidgeotto! Ash was on a roll...

Later on in his journies, he would be encountered by Team Rocket, a notorious group that planned to steal Ash's Pikachu! But Ash always thwarted their money scheming plans and sent them blasting off again and again! But Team Rocket was the least of his worries... He was still learning to be a Pokémon trainer... and he still had so much to learn! Soon, his Caterpie evolved into a Metapod... and Ash had to learn to respect his 'new' Pokémon. It was with Metapod (after Pikachu) did Ash learn compassion and empathy for his Pokémon... and with this bond, Ash would be able to train his Pokémon to be the best! And because Ash loved Metapod so much, it evolved onto Butterfree!

Now, Ash was able to catch some more Pokémon. He earned the trust of a hard-headed but loyal and protective Bulbasaur from a secret village. Then he helped to save the life and gain the companionship of a young Charmander. Finally, he tamed the wild and rebelious Squirtle! With these three Pokémon, Ash became more stronger and wiser...
